鸡白痢沙门氏菌invA基因的克隆与原核表达

摘要:
【目的】克隆鸡白痢沙门氏菌侵袭蛋白A(invA)基因并进行原核表达,分析重组蛋白invA的抗原性,为沙门氏菌快速诊断试纸条和新型表位疫苗的研发提供理论依据。【方法】以鸡白痢沙门氏菌野毒株为供试菌,克隆其invA基因,对invA基因编码的蛋白进行生物信息学分析。将invA基因克隆到pET-30a原核表达载体上,构建原核重组表达质粒pET-30a invA,将其转化到大肠杆菌BL21(DE3)中进行诱导表达,对表达产物进行SDS-PAGE和Western-blot分析,检测其目的蛋白的表达情况和免疫反应特性。【结果】成功获得了1 143 bp的完整的invA基因, 编码381个氨基酸。生物信息学分析结果表明,invA基因编码的蛋白有17个抗原决定簇,其跨膜区域明显,92-105位氨基酸为low complexity典型结构域。构建获得了原核重组表达质粒pET-30a-invA,在大肠杆菌BL21(DE3)中成功表达了约51 ku的invA融合蛋白;Western-blot检测结果显示,该融合蛋白具有良好的免疫反应性。【结论】成功克隆出了1 143 bp大小invA基因,明确了其编码蛋白的生物信息,其诱导表达后获得免疫反应性良好的重组蛋白。

Cloning and prokaryotic expression of invA gene from Salmonella pullorum

Abstract:
【Objective】Cloning of Salmonella pullorum invasion protein A (invA) gene and prokaryotic expression, analysis of the antigenicity of recombinant protein invA,in order to lay a theoretical foundation for further research of the Salmonella pullorum rapid diagnosis test strips and new epitope vaccine research.【Method】 Salmonella pullorum strains as a test strain,the invA gene was cloned and the bioinformatics analysis that the invA gene was carried out.The invA gene was subcloned into the prokaryotic expression vector pET-30a,strucure pronucleus recombinant plasmid pET-30a-invA.The recombinant plasmid was transformed into E.coli BL21(DE3).The expressed protein was identified by SDS-PAGE and Western-blotting;and detection of its target protein expression and immune response characteristics.【Result】Obtained a complete length of invA gene was about 1 143 bp successfully, which could encode 381 amino acids residues.Bioinformatics results showed that the protein encoded by invA gene had 17 antigenic determinants,and its transmembrane region was obvious,the protein had a domain which corresponding to the typical domain of low complexity between the 92-105 amino acids.The recombinant plasmid pET-30a-invA was successfully constructed and expressed as about 51 ku of fusion protein invA in E.coli BL21(DE3).Western blotting showed that the fusion protein had good immunoreactivity.【Conclusion】Cloned the invA gene successfully,which the length of invA gene was 1 143 bp size,and the biological information of the protein was confirmed,and the recombinant protein has good immunogenicity.
